Job Summary:
- The Medical Imaging Technologist under the direction of the Medical Director and/or Section Head, the manager, and Radiologist performs technical procedures and assists in the clinical evaluation and care of the patients.
- The Medical Imaging Technologist utilizes their specific modality to create diagnostic images and provide their patients with a safe positive experience.
- In radiation producing modalities technologists’ practice and enforce the radiation safety measures in New York State Department of health code part 16.
- Technologists support teaching and continue learning as the technology changes for both themselves and others.
Requirements:
- Associate degree Applied Science Degree – required.
- Diploma in X-Ray – required.
- Vocational School Diploma Graduate of an approved professional academic imaging program – required.
- Previous experience helpful – preferred.
- Maintains competent imaging skills in practicing modality/s.
- Practices in compliance with Hospital /department policy as well as New York state and accrediting agency’s standards.
- Demonstrates the knowledge and skills necessary to provide patient care appropriate to the age and special characteristics of the patient.
- Provides a safe positive experience for the patient.
- ARRT – American Registry of Radiologic Technologists Registered Upon Hire – required.
- New York State registration or possess a limited permit to practice in the State of New York Upon Hire – required.
- American Heart Association Basic Life Support (BLS) Certified upon hire required.
